在日常使用Word时,我们经常会遇到文档中存在大量空行的情况。这些空行可能会影响文档的美观和阅读体验,因此需要及时清理。那么,如何高效地删除Word文档中的所有空行呢?以下是一些实用的方法,帮助你轻松解决这一问题。
方法一:利用查找与替换功能
这是最常用也是最简单的方法之一。具体操作步骤如下:
1. 打开你的Word文档。
2. 按下快捷键Ctrl + H,打开“查找和替换”对话框。
3. 在“查找内容”框中输入一个双引号(即""),这代表一个空格或空行。
4. 在“替换为”框中同样输入一个双引号。
5. 点击“全部替换”按钮。此时,Word会自动将文档中的所有空行删除。
这种方法适用于大多数情况,但如果文档中有多个连续的空行,可能需要重复几次才能完全清除。
方法二:使用宏命令
如果你经常需要处理含有大量空行的文档,可以考虑创建一个简单的宏来自动完成这项任务。
1. 首先按Alt + F11打开VBA编辑器。
2. 在菜单栏选择“插入” -> “模块”,然后输入以下代码:
```vba
Sub RemoveBlankLines()
Selection.Find.ClearFormatting
Selection.Find.Replacement.ClearFormatting
With Selection.Find
.Text = "^p^p"
.Replacement.Text = "^p"
.Forward = True
.Wrap = wdFindContinue
.Format = False
.MatchCase = False
.MatchWholeWord = False
.MatchWildcards = False
.MatchSoundsLike = False
.MatchAllWordForms = False
End With
Selection.Find.Execute Replace:=wdReplaceAll
End Sub
```
3. 关闭VBA编辑器并返回到Word界面。
4. 按下Alt + F8运行刚才创建的宏,即可一次性删除文档中的所有空行。
方法三:手动调整段落设置
如果文档中的空行数量不多,也可以通过手动调整段落设置来解决。
1. 选中包含空行的部分文本。
2. 右键点击选中的区域,在弹出的菜单中选择“段落”。
3. 在弹出的“段落”窗口中,找到“间距”选项卡。
4. 将“之前”和“之后”的数值设置为0,并取消勾选“如果定义了为段落添加间距,则增加段前间距”。
5. 确定后应用更改。
这种方法虽然较为繁琐,但对于小范围内的空行清理非常有效。
注意事项
- 在执行任何操作之前,请确保已经保存好原始文档,以防误操作导致数据丢失。
- 如果文档中含有格式化的特殊字符(如换行符等),请谨慎使用上述方法,以免误删其他重要内容。
- 对于复杂的文档结构,建议先备份原文件再尝试上述方法。
通过以上几种方式,你可以根据自身需求选择最适合的方法来清理Word文档中的空行。无论是简单的查找替换还是借助宏命令,都能让你的工作更加高效便捷。希望这些技巧能够帮助你在处理文档时事半功倍!